QUOTE originally posted by Mio Xenoblade

just gonna throw my two cents into the ring here as a host - i think the trade rule needs to be reworded, even if you just remove the word "unrelated" from the title or add some extra clarification. there are a lot of arguments to be made for what should and shouldn't be allowed as a "related" trade. for example, why is asking to buy type-matching summon items one time considered unrelated, even if people have to pm to take that offer up? not selling them to other players? i made this mistake due to thinking that summons wouldn't count as an unrelated trade. obviously things like gems, rte mons, shiny charms etc do not benefit the team as a whole - only one person - so i see why they're disallowed. but summons help the team as a whole get more points. as skiddo said, things like egg supplier passes, and other things like the red gigaremo, help the team as a whole get more points. i'm also the type of person that needs everything spelled out exactly for me or i will make mistakes like this and i'm sure i'm not the only one. even if these things are not planned on being allowed, making a definitive list of what is and isn't allowed in a hidebox in the main type race rules thread might be a good idea.

QUOTE originally posted by Mirzam

I kind of understand where you're coming from, but it kind of feels against the spirit and the culture of this site and the type race to restrict that kind of trade. Helping your team members with pairs is not fully altruistic in the context of the type race: a person with a good pair for a Pokemon they really want to hunt is more likely to earn more points, and thus contribute more to the team goal. The trade forum is massively inefficient in comparison. I like helping my team members build pairs, again because it's nice and it's easy and because it also benefits me, but I'm really not willing to scroll pages and pages in the trade forum looking for my teammates who are trying to get pairs ahead of the race. I think the shiny giveaways and special hatching announcements are way more spammy and less helpful than this kind of trading. My point here isn't that those should be banned, it's just that different people have different goals and opinions on the type race thread, and what's spam to one is cool or helpful to another. Trying to restrict it so strictly just feels kind of disheartening, I'm too worried about what's "allowed" vs having fun in a team activity.
